How much do vehicle operations manager j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 24, 2026, the average yearly pay for vehicle operations manager in Forney, TX is $57,165.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$36,900.00 and $69,800.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a vehicle operations manager?

To thrive as a Vehicle Operations Manager, you need expertise in fleet management, logistics, and maintenance, often supported by a degree in business, logistics, or a related field. Familiarity with fleet management software, GPS tracking systems, and compliance regulations is typically required. Strong leadership, problem-solving, and effective communication skills are vital for coordinating teams and resolving operational challenges. These abilities ensure efficient vehicle utilization, regulatory compliance, and smooth day-to-day operations within the organization.

What are some common challenges faced by vehicle operations managers in coordinating fleet maintenance and scheduling?

Vehicle Operations Managers often encounter challenges in balancing vehicle availability with maintenance schedules, especially when managing a large or diverse fleet. Unexpected breakdowns or urgent repairs can disrupt planned routes and require quick decision-making to reassign vehicles or adjust schedules. Effective communication with drivers, maintenance teams, and dispatchers is crucial to minimize downtime and ensure operational efficiency. Utilizing fleet management software can help streamline scheduling, but adapting to rapidly changing demands remains a key part of the role.

What does a vehicle operations manager do?

A vehicle operations manager oversees the daily functions of a fleet of vehicles, including scheduling maintenance, ensuring safety compliance, managing drivers, and optimizing routes for efficiency. They often use fleet management software and require strong organizational and leadership skills to coordinate operations effectively.

As a Vehicle Operations Specialist, your primary responsibility is to manage all onsite vehicles including sales inventory, used vehicles, lease returns, and internal fleet in partnership with both on-site and HQ-based teams. The Vehicle Operations Specialist is a critical partner in ensuring the readiness of inventory, flow of vehicle movements, and accuracy of inventory tracking. We prioritize a world-class customer service experience, and our Vehicle Operations Specialist plays a key role in continuing to build upon the Lucid Motors brand through their organization and support of the sales team.

Our ideal candidate has an unwavering commitment to the accurate collection and recording of information and possesses demonstrable interpersonal and communication skills. You are meticulously detailed, well-organized, and understand the critical nature of setting daily priorities.

The Role:

  • Monitor and manage the location's physical vehicle inventory, ensuring inventory vehicles are in ready-to-sell condition and that lots are clean and well organized
  • Conduct lot walks and physical inventory to ensure inventory accuracy
  • Partner with internal allocations team to inform of inventory needs
  • Ensure inventory is well-maintained and appealing, performing software updates, cleaning and charging vehicles as required
  • Partner with internal teams to manage lease return, trade-in and fleet vehicles on-site
  • Coordinate logistics for vehicle movements as required between Lucid facilities and third-party locations
  • Monitor inbound shipments of vehicles from manufacturing or third-party facilities
  • Perform and verify vehicle intake inspection and ensure inbound cars comply with quality standards per Lucid's defined quality intake assessment  
  • Liaise with Service team in case of required repair work 
  • Partner with sales teams on the status of vehicle readiness 
  • Assist with new vehicle deliveries during high volume periods and daily operations as required

Lucid Motors is a highly innovative electric vehicle manufacturer located in Newark, CA, USA. Primarily engaged in the automotive industry, its mission is to elevate electric vehicles' standing and transform the way people travel. The company was founded in 2007 by Bernard Tse and Sam Weng as Atieva, a name under which it initially focused on battery technology. However, it pivoted towards automotive manufacturing and rebranded as Lucid Motors in 2016. The company is committed to making luxury, sustainable electric vehicles that break norms and set new standards with top-notch technology and engineering. Their mission aligns with their core values, which are centered around innovation, sustainability, and excellence. Notably, Lucid Motors launched the Lucid Air in 2020, an all-electric sedan well-received for its advanced features and impressive mileage.
